10000 contenu connexe trouvé
Comprendre la technologie de mise en cache TiDB
Présentation de l'article:TiDB est une base de données NewSQL distribuée qui peut répondre aux exigences de haute disponibilité et de hautes performances des applications d'entreprise. La technologie de mise en cache est une partie importante de TiDB et peut améliorer efficacement les performances des requêtes TiDB. Cet article discutera de la technologie de mise en cache de TiDB. Introduction au cache TiDB Le cache TiDB se compose principalement de deux parties, l'une est le cache TiKV et l'autre est le cache TiDBServer. La fonction principale du cache TiKV est d'accélérer un seul TiK
2023-06-20
commentaire 0
956
Dans quelle mesure le langage Go est-il utilisé dans TiDB ?
Présentation de l'article:Dans quelle mesure le langage Go est-il utilisé dans TiDB ? TiDB est un système de base de données NewSQL distribué présentant les caractéristiques de haute disponibilité, de hautes performances et de stockage distribué. En tant que langage de développement de TiDB, le langage Go est largement utilisé dans le développement de ses modules fonctionnels de base internes. Cet article explorera le degré d'application du langage Go dans TiDB et démontrera son rôle dans TiDB à travers des exemples de code spécifiques. 1. Degré d'application du langage Go dans TiDB En tant que système de base de données distribuée haute performance, TiDB a
2024-03-24
commentaire 0
673
Dernier lancement de TiDB 1.0-PINGCAP !
Présentation de l'article:PingCAP lance TiDB 1.0, une solution de base de données hybride évolutive. Le 16 octobre 2017, PingCAP Inc., une société de technologie de base de données distribuée de pointe, a officiellement annoncé la sortie de TiDB 1.0. TiDB est une base de données open source de transaction hybride distribuée/traitement analytique (HTAP) qui permet aux entreprises d'utiliser une seule base de données pour satisfaire les deux charges de travail. Dans l'environnement de base de données actuel, les ingénieurs en infrastructure utilisent généralement une base de données pour le traitement des transactions en ligne (OLTP) et une autre pour le traitement analytique en ligne (OLAP). TiDB vise à briser cette séparation en créant une base de données HTAP pour une analyse commerciale en temps réel basée sur des données de transaction en temps réel. Avec TiDB,
2024-01-15
commentaire 0
1226
La technologie derrière TiDB utilise-t-elle le langage Go ?
Présentation de l'article:La technologie derrière TiDB utilise-t-elle le langage Go ? Ces dernières années, le langage Go, en tant que langage de programmation efficace, concis et hautement simultané, a progressivement attiré l'attention et la faveur dans le domaine du développement logiciel. Le domaine du développement de bases de données ne fait pas exception. En tant que système de base de données distribuée open source, TiDB est très respecté dans l'industrie. Alors, la technologie derrière TiDB utilise-t-elle le langage Go ? Cet article expliquera comment les technologies liées aux bases de données TiDB utilisent le langage Go pour améliorer les performances et l'évolutivité. Tout d'abord, toute la base de données TiDB
2024-03-24
commentaire 0
869
Le tidb est-il le langage de prédilection ?
Présentation de l'article:Oui, TiDB est écrit en langage Go. TiDB est une base de données NewSQL distribuée ; elle prend en charge l'expansion élastique horizontale, les transactions ACID, le SQL standard, la syntaxe MySQL et le protocole MySQL, et possède une forte cohérence des données et des fonctionnalités de haute disponibilité. Le PD dans l'architecture TiDB stocke les méta-informations du cluster, telles que le nœud TiKV sur lequel se trouve la clé ; le PD est également responsable de l'équilibrage de charge et du partage des données du cluster ; PD prend en charge la distribution des données et la tolérance aux pannes en intégrant etcd. PD est écrit en langage Go.
2022-12-02
commentaire 0
6111
Comparaison des capacités de réplication entre centres de données entre TiDB et MySQL
Présentation de l'article:Comparaison des capacités de réplication entre centres de données de TiDB et MySQL : TiDB est une base de données relationnelle distribuée qui peut atteindre une haute disponibilité et une reprise après sinistre grâce à la réplication entre centres de données. MySQL propose également des moyens de réaliser une réplication entre centres de données. Cet article comparera les similitudes et les différences entre TiDB et MySQL en termes de capacités de réplication entre centres de données et donnera des exemples de code correspondants. 1. Capacité de réplication entre centres de données de TiDB La capacité de réplication entre centres de données de TiDB est obtenue en utilisant le CDC (Cha
2023-07-12
commentaire 0
980
TiDB est-il écrit en langage Go ?
Présentation de l'article:TiDB est une base de données relationnelle distribuée open source écrite en langage Go. Le langage Go est un langage de programmation open source développé par Google. Il présente des performances de concurrence efficaces et une syntaxe concise, ce qui fait du langage Go un choix idéal pour développer des systèmes distribués. Dans le code source de TiDB, on peut clairement voir un grand nombre de codes écrits en langage Go. Ce qui suit est un exemple simple de code dans TiDB : packagemainimport "fmt"
2024-03-24
commentaire 0
1043
Installation de CentOS TiDB
Présentation de l'article:Tracert d'installation CentOS Les utilisateurs familiers avec les systèmes LINUX savent que l'installation de certains logiciels couramment utilisés sur CentOS peut rencontrer des difficultés. Car contrairement à d’autres systèmes d’exploitation, CentOS ne préinstalle pas certains logiciels courants. Aujourd'hui, nous allons vous présenter comment installer TiDB et tracert sur CentOS. TiDB est un système de base de données distribuée open source avec une évolutivité horizontale et une haute disponibilité. Il est très approprié pour le traitement de transactions en ligne à grande échelle et le traitement d'analyse en ligne. Ensuite, nous présenterons les étapes pour installer TiDB sur le système d'exploitation CentOS. 1. Vous devez installer Docker sur CentOS, vous pouvez utiliser la commande suivante pour installer Docker : "
2024-02-29
commentaire 0
910
La base de code de TiDB est-elle entièrement basée sur le langage Go ?
Présentation de l'article:TiDB est un système de base de données distribuée open source équipé du moteur de stockage distribué TiKV et de la couche de requête TiDB, visant à fournir aux utilisateurs des solutions de base de données hautes performances et hautement évolutives. La base de code TiDB implémente les fonctions principales de la base de données, tandis que TiKV est responsable du stockage persistant des données et du traitement des transactions. Dans la base de code TiDB, la plupart du code est écrit sur la base du langage Go. C'est également l'une des intentions de conception initiales du projet TiDB, car le langage Go offre des performances de concurrence efficaces et riches.
2024-03-24
commentaire 0
552